Safety

As every parent will tell you, selecting the best car seat for your child is among the most crucial decisions that you could make. The best car seat for newborn uk seat will ensure that they're in the right position correctly in the car and ensure they're protected in the event of a crash.

While every car seat sold in the US must adhere to strict standards established by the National Highway Traffic Safety Administration (NHTSA) Not all seats are created equal. Some models have features that are designed to protect infants. For instance load legs can minimize movement during crashes by absorbing the impact forces on the car seat and base. Others include bubble levels that make installing easy and adjustable headrests for your growing baby.

Choi says that infant car seats are designed to provide the perfect fit for babies. They usually include crash-tested inserts which aid in this. They're also lighter than a convertible car seats and can be easily transformed into a stroller. This makes them suitable for drop-offs at daycares, rides, and pick-ups. You can purchase an used one for less than the cost as they're only used for the first 12 months.

A high NHTSA score and excellent crash test results are important however, the method you use to install the car seat of your child is more important. In fact, a study done by Portland's leading children's hospital revealed that 95 percent of parents made at the very least one crucial mistake when installing or positioning their car seat.

It's important to familiarize yourself prior to when your baby arrives by ensuring that you know the proper guidelines for car seats. We suggest looking for a car seat that has clear and concise instructions, is lightweight enough to be easy to carry your child in it and comes with easy-to-use adjustment mechanisms.

It is also important to verify that the infant car seat you're considering fits the size requirements for your vehicle. If you're worried about your ability to install and operate the car seat correctly by yourself, you may want to take it to a certified Child Passenger Safety Technician (CPST) before your baby is born for a hands on demonstration.

Comfort

The best infant car seats come with features for comfort that allow you to easily get your baby into and out of the seat. The top infant car seats feature a one-handed clasp system which eliminates the need to grasp both sides simultaneously. They also come with cushioned padding that makes it easier to lift the seat. In addition, you'll need to consider how much weight the seat weighs. You'll be using it without a base in the end and a lighter weight is better. This Baby Trend Secure Lift is a good example. It weighs less than 13 pounds.

Other important aspects include the weight and height limits of the infant car seat rear facing car seat. If you plan to keep the car seat, select one that can adapt to your child's needs and allow them to transition into the toddlerhood. You can use it longer and save money by not purchasing another seat.

It is also important to consider the dimensions of the seat, and whether it is narrower or wider than other models. The first can be useful for smaller vehicles. The second may be helpful when you have three kids in the rear seat or two children in back-to-back car seats. If you plan to use a car seat along with a pram, you should choose one that is compatible with the most popular strollers, and includes removable seats. Brands such as Graco or Nuna have options that will meet your needs.

Review the rating of a car seat for ease of use. Clearly labeled guides and indicators that inform you that the seat is level and securely fastened--like bubble levels or color coding--can assist in easing the burden on the new parents. Some seats also have unique features like load legs, which are shock-absorbing components located beneath the seat or base that extend out to the floor of the vehicle to absorb some of the impact force during a crash.

There are additional accessories that claim to enhance the convenience and comfort of your car seat. However, remember that anything not included with the seat hasn't undergone safety tests. Segura recommends that you don't put anything else in your car seat, including a blanket or harness you purchased elsewhere.

Style

It can be a challenge for new parents to determine the best infant car seats. It's important that you understand your budget and what features you'd like. There are many options in terms of special features, stroller compatibility, and fabrics but a lot is based on what's comfortable for babies.

For instance, it's worth noting that infant-specific seats fit smaller babies better than convertible car seats and are suitable for the first year of their lives (though some might have extensions that have been tested for crash to help them last longer). They also tend to have more recline modes to ensure proper positioning for smaller children, and are generally lighter to make it easier to carry around. They are also more likely to work with a travel system, which is beneficial for new parents trying to save time and money by buying one seat that can perform double duty.

Another thing to keep in mind is that car seat weight and width are crucial aspects for the majority of families. Certain infant car seats, like, are narrower to fit better in the back of your car or next to other seats. Some are heavy enough to really test your biceps to lift and transfer from car to stroller.

When it comes to convenience, a lot of parents choose infant car seats that have the capability to move from base to carrier and then snap into a stroller, without the need for extra attachments. This will save you a lot of time, especially on busy days when you're running errands your children.

Other convenient features include a harness that doesn't need to be rethread with magnetic buckle holders, as well as an easy-to-install process. Finally, you should look for an head and body support insert, which can help prevent infants from slumping in the carrier or seat when they are asleep.

Most car seats have flexible straps for their lower anchor connectors however, some have latches that are rigid and flip out of the base and turn green once installed.
